To provide a brazing method for a rectangular metallic ring, a method by which a minute rectangular metallic ring can be brazed on a ceramic substrate free from positional and angular deviations and by which facilities for the brazing can be simplified.
This method includes: a process 3 of applying a temporal tacking agent on a metallic layer which is stuck, on a ceramic substrate, in a shape roughly corresponding to the planar shape of the rectangular metallic ring; a process 4 of placing, on the temporal tacking agent, the rectangular metallic ring which is formed with a clad material of a metallic layer and a brazing filler metal; and a process 5 of brazing the rectangular metallic ring on the ceramic substrate by fusing the brazing filler metal and vaporizing or thermally decomposing the temporal tacking agent. In the process 3 of applying the temporal tacking agent, the temporal tacking agent is applied in a manner at least nearly dotted in a pair on the opposite sides on the metallic layer which is stuck in the shape roughly corresponding to the planar shape of the rectangular metallic ring. In the process 4 of placing the metallic ring, positional correction is performed with only the X and Y axes as the basic axes.
